Kallang Riverside Posted by: eblur1
Video duration: 34 seconds Kallang Riverside is a popular spot for Dragon boat members and canoe polo players to have their trainings. The surroundings are mainly just highways and waters which can ease their distractions unlike other places. It is also quite quiet with only the waters around them unlike the Esplanade with lots of noise and activities. Related: travel |

Haji Lane Posted by: eblur1
Video duration: 14 seconds Haji Lane is now popular with their Sheesha activities which only attract a certain age group. In addition with the hip style retails now, only youths are seen in that area, losing most of its authentic essence of Arab and Malay culture in the past. Related: travel |

Queen St Bus Terminal Posted by: eblur1
Video duration: 35 seconds Queen Street Bus Terminal is also a stop for Singapore-Johore-Tax i service to and fro Malaysia. The engines from the buses and taxis are pretty loud causing sound pollution together with the crowds waiting for the transports. It is not convenient at all as people have to jaywalk to get to that area, if not they would have to make a big turn from the traffic light. Related: travel |
